ELIZABETH CITY, NC | The ECSU football team returns to Roebuck Stadium after a month on the road to face Virginia State on Saturday afternoon. The Vikings look to snap a three-game losing streak in this CIAA match-up.
Who: Elizabeth City State (2-4, 0-3 CIAA vs. Virginia State (3-3, 2-1 CIAA)
Where: Elizabeth City, NC (Roebuck Stadium)
When: Saturday, October 19, at 1 p.m.
Where to watch: CIAA Sports Network
Theme: Pink Game/Breast Cancer Awareness
Match-up history
The Vikings are 5-12 all-time against the VSU Trojans dating back to the first meeting in 2004.
Last time out
The Vikings suffered a 35-0 versus Virginia Union last week in Richmond.
Defensive numbers
- The Vikings rank fifth in the conference in defensive scoring, allowing 18.8 points per game.
- The Vikings rank sixth in total defense allowing, 317.2 yards per game.
- Demorian Smith ranks seventh in the conference in tackles with 43 averaging 7.5 per game and 13th in forced fumbles.
- TreShaun Harris ranks 13th in tackles with 31 total (18 solo and 13 assists) and fourth in sacks with three.
